8. are we still friends (9.5/10)
not very impressive on its own, but as a closer to the story of igor it is a cinematic experience. since my first listen, 3:10 to the end has been a highlight for me. the chaotic and clashing nature of the instrumental captures tylerâs-
not very impressive on its own, but as a closer to the story of igor it is a cinematic experience. since my first listen, 3:10 to the end has been a highlight for me. the chaotic and clashing nature of the instrumental captures tylerâs-
mental state perfectly as he has finally separated himself from this person causing him so much pain but is still clinging on to the hope of them staying in his life, coalescing to a scream at the end and fading into a synth chord that doesnât resolve until-
the beginning of igors theme- symbolizing the cycle tyler has found himself in of love and heartbreak
7. i dont love you anymore (10/10)
tyler finally steps back on idlya and realizes his worth, saying âi wonât walk around with my head down like i got beat upâ in the first half of this song, but this quickly turns into âmoving on but how?â and he starts to doubt his choice and-

almost drowns amidst a sea of beautiful harmonies metaphorically representing his conflicted feelings that overwhelm him, until itâs eventually cut off by him reminding himself âi dont love you anymoreâ

5. puppet (10/10)
puppet features tyler at his most desperate, willing to do anything for this person after telling them âi donât want to see you againâ in a seemingly pivotal moment on a boy is a gun. he is loyal to a fault, taking one step forward and two steps back.-

the way the beat comes in smoothly and minimally on the first hook feels heavy and dragged, representing how tyler feels pulled by this person and the way he becomes a pushover when it comes to them, losing all ability to stick up for himself
4. gone gone/thank you (10/10)
tyler reminisces on the good times he had before the breakup in a youthful and nostalgic tone, but the hook comes in sharply, pleading âmy loves goneâ, and refers to his current state as âa dream i just canât seem to wake up fromâ, which is-

reminiscent of how he describes what is assumed to be the same person on see you again, (âyou live in my dream stateâ âi donât wanna wake upâ). what he thought was perfect has actually caused him heartbreak and now he wishes to wake from it. also on this track he begins toaccept-
that their time together has come to an end,it has some of the saddest lines imoâi just hope to god she got good taste,can put you on some shit you never seenâ,âi hope you know she canât compete with meâ.the second half is even more hopeless, claiming he never wants to love again

1. new magic wand (10/10)
potentially my favorite song tyler has ever made. in contrast to the previous tracks, tyler begins to experience, jealously, envy, anger, and insecurity over the presence of someone he perceives as a threat to his relationship and fantasizes about-

getting rid of both of them. beyond his anger though, there is a deep underlying sadness found in his repetition of âplease donât leave me nowâat increasing levels at which you can hear him descend into a darker place until the next lines about wanting all of his love for himself
so many impactful lines on nmw, such as âi live life with no fear except for the idea that one day you wonât be hereâ and âi will not fetch the ballâ, hard to briefly explain all that i love about this song, but hopefully that got some of it across.
